IEEE - 2735

Interoperability of Complex Virtual Instruments for Internet of Things

active, Most Current
Organization: IEEE
Publication Date: 8 November 2022
Status: active
Page Count: 54
scope:

This standard provides the definitions and terminologies, reference model, and data structure of Complex Virtual Instruments (CVIs) for Internet of Things (IoT ). CVIs framework, including architectural model, protocols, and data interface requirements are also defined to allow for flexible and scalable solutions to CVIs Interoperability and easy-to-implement cloud services that are able to be maintained in a sustainable manner.

Purpose

This standard addresses interoperability issues of Complex Virtual Instruments (CVIs) for Internet of Things (IoT ) and provides CVIs framework and requirements that outline the technologies and processes to help ensure flexible, reliable, and sustainable solutions to interoperability issues of IoT system. This standard assists developers in adopting CVIs-based development methods in building IoT software system, improves development efficiency by leveraging reusable and configurable CVIs, aids IoT enterprises to accelerate integration of IoT heterogeneous data, lays data foundation for big data analysis and applications, and promotes management level and usage of IoT data.
